Tools for changing configuration and for managing

Tools for changing configuration and for managing

Software tools summary: describes a variety of software tools that you can use to install, configure, and manage a network printer. These tools cover a variety of functions in a variety of operating environments. In general, they allow you to set parameters for the various protocols listed

below...

Embedded web server: describes the web server contained within the print server. You can use this tool to configure and manage the print server.

HP Web Jetadmin: used to install, configure, and/or monitor the networked printer, this software is available at http://www.hp.com/support/net_printing.

Security for configuration: describes the security offered by the various ways of configuring and managing the print server.

Protocols

The following protocols, and protocol-specific configurations and tools, are supported by the print server.

TCP/IP: includes an overview of TCP/IP, as well as information on these methods of applying TCP/IP parameters to the print server:

DHCP: a tool for autoconfiguration

BOOTP: a tool for autoconfiguration

TFTP: a tool for extended autoconfiguration

RARP: a tool on some systems for configuring an IP address

Telnet: a tool for configuration and monitoring the print server

embedded web server: a tool for configuration and management

ports for IP access reference summary

moving the print server to another IP network: notes

LPD (line printer daemon) printing: can be set up using these LPD instructions
